Executive Summary
PureCycle Technologies priced a $395M concurrent offering of $250M 4.75% convertible notes due 2032 and 17.66M common shares at $8.21/share. Net proceeds (~$379M combined) will primarily fund the repurchase of ~$216M of outstanding 7.25% green convertible notes due 2030, reducing interest expense and extending debt maturity. The refinancing is credit-positive but the large equity component is dilutive to existing common shareholders.

Key Facts
- Priced $250M aggregate principal of 4.75% convertible senior notes due 2032
- Concurrently priced 17,661,388 common shares at $8.21/share for ~$145M gross proceeds
- Combined gross proceeds of $395M; net proceeds estimated at ~$379M
- Net proceeds to repurchase ~$216M of existing 7.25% green convertible notes due 2030
- Initial conversion price of ~$11.08/share, a 35% premium to the $8.21 offering price
- Underwriters have 30-day options for up to $37.5M additional notes and 2.28M additional shares
- Expected closing on or about June 15, 2026
Financial Impact
Combined gross proceeds of $395M; net proceeds ~$379M after underwriting discounts and expenses. The $216M debt repurchase eliminates higher-cost 7.25% debt, reducing annual interest expense by ~$5.4M (216M × 2.5% spread).
Risk Factors
- Dilution from 17.66M new shares plus potential 2.28M additional shares from over-allotment
- Conversion of notes could further dilute equity if stock trades above $11.08
- Execution risk on repurchasing the green convertible notes in privately negotiated transactions
- Market conditions may affect the closing of either offering
